Audit Manager - Charities and Social Enterprises

Hi, We're Sayer Vincent and we're not your typical audit firm!

We've been around for quite a while... established in

1983

by three accountants committed to social justice. They saw the need for dedicated specialist audit and advice for charities and social purpose organisations. Our company is growing and adapting but we're pleased to say our founding ethos is still a drive at the firm to this day.

We make charities become more effective at what they do - which in turn helps their beneficiaries. So, if you are passionate about causes, working for us would be right up your street!

We really value what every individual brings to our business and believe our people are the most important part. Providing a supportive culture where everyone can learn, develop and grow whilst really understanding what they bring to the business.

About your role

Key responsibilities include: Leading and managing end to end client assignments within agreed budget and timetable. Leading, developing and maintaining excellent relationships with clients, from initial contact and tendering through to on-going fee negotiations, retention and expansion of our work with them. Leading, managing and developing people, actively participating in the training and development of our trainees. Contributing to implementation of technical changes, client training and the firm's development. About You

You are a Chartered Accountant with an audit qualification and experience in managing audits, including audits with a range of levels of turnover and complexity and interaction to FD/chief executive level. Experience in managing a portfolio of clients as well as participating in the new client tendering process. Have experience coaching more junior colleagues and ideally managing trainees going through their ACA qualification. You will have a deep knowledge and understanding of the charity and not-for-profit sector is desirable, along with the ability to deliver strategic planning and thinking. You will enjoy working with other people and possess good face to face and written communication skills, particularly when interacting with people from a non-financial background. The ideal candidate will be comfortable working in a matrix management structure and have a good ability to manage multiple deadlines. Work with a friendly, supportive team of people
